Simon is as … Webb16 apr. 2024 · Tradition says more about Simon of Cyrene. For example, some say that he had dark skin because he was from Cyrene, which was located on the northern tip of Africa. Throughout church history, most art images depict Simon of Cyrene as a black man. Actually, we don’t know the color of his skin.
Webb7 apr. 2024 · Cyrene is a region in the Roman province of Libya in North Africa, which has led to some speculation that Simon of Cyrene was black. The fact is, we do not know the color of his skin. We do know that Cyrene had a large population of the Jewish diaspora. Simon, like many Jews, had likely come to Jerusalem to celebrate the passover.
